Under 3.5 goals (-177): Madrid will be desperate for goals, but there should be no rush when Arsenal has possession.
In fact, I’m sure the English side would be happy with the most boring game possible.
And that’s because Arsenal holds a comfortable 3-0 lead on aggregate.
I expect a thwarting attack from Los Blancos at home, but I also expect the Gunners’ defenders to hold strong.
Arsenal allows the second fewest goals per game (0.5) in the Champions League this season.
The away side will be without top defender Gabriel, who went down with an injury a few weeks ago.
Jakub Kiwior returned at the perfect time, however, and has filled in at centre half nicely. He played the full 90 minutes in the first leg and helped hold Madrid’s attack to three shots on target.
Arsenal should be happy to play a defensively strong formation and slow the pace down by holding possession. That’ll lead to fewer opportunities for the Spanish side.

Bellingham over 0.5 SOT (-186): Whether Real Madrid needs goals or not, Bellingham is often involved in the opposing third.
He has at least a shot on goal in four of the past five matches. He claimed one of those few Real Madrid shots in the first leg, as well.
Carlo Ancelotti’s squad will be pressing for goals while taking risks that wouldn’t be needed in most cases. As the game goes on, the shot attempts will get more desperate, but that’s good for this wager.
And I think this is more than a fair price for Bellingham to get a shot on target, especially when his side is pushing for offence.
Rice over 0.5 shots (-205): It was the English midfielder who was the hero in the first leg, scoring two brilliant free kicks past Thibaut Courtois.
Rice has attempted a shot in each of the past 12 games across all competitions. He’s shown to be very reliable against this line.
Arsenal will be in no rush for offence, but it can’t sit back and invite pressure either. If Rice finds himself in a spot to let it fly, I don’t see why he wouldn’t.
He also has the advantage of being the Gunners’ free-kick taker. That can lead to a free shot opportunity on any Real Madrid foul around its penalty area.
